Abstract
The utility model discloses a sealing device of a drum sieve. The sealing device comprises a bottom cylindrical shell of the drum sieve and a sieve drum positioned above the bottom cylindrical shell, wherein a fixing ring corresponding to the sieve drum is fixedly arranged on the bottom cylindrical shell of the drum sieve and a rotating ring is fixedly arranged on the lower end of the sieve drum. The outer ring of the fixing ring is provided with an upward protruding first annular baffle plate, and a gap is arranged between the first annular baffle plate and the rotating ring. A downward protruding second annular baffle plate is fixed on the inner ring of the rotating ring, and a gap is arranged between the second annular baffle plate and the fixing ring. The fixing ring, the first annular baffle plate, the rotating ring and the second annular baffle plate form a half-enclosed cavity, and circular centers of the fixing ring, the first annular baffle plate, the rotating ring, the second annular baffle plate, the sieve drum and the bottom cylindrical shell are on a same axis. The sealing device ensures better sealing effect between sieve drum of the rotary sieve and the bottom of the cylindrical shell, thereby ensuring the rate of removing heavy slag, and improving the full stuff quality of the device.
